The Beat Master!

Imagine a band playing music so loud and exciting it makes you want to jump up and dance! That's what Rick Buckler did as the drummer for a famous English band called The Jam. He was the one hitting the drums with all his might, making the music thump and groove. He helped make their songs sound amazing, like the heartbeat of the band!

Drumming Through the Years!

Rick Buckler was born a long, long time ago, on December 6, 1955. He played drums for The Jam for many years, helping them become super popular. After The Jam stopped playing, Rick didn't stop making music! He played in other bands and even helped make music in a studio. It’s like he always had a drumstick in his hand, ready to make some noise!

More Than Just Drums!

Rick Buckler was a really important part of The Jam. Even though the singer wrote many songs, Rick and the bass player were like the engine of the band, making everything sound powerful. Sometimes, people didn't remember how much they helped, but Rick knew! He was a true music maker, and his drumming is still loved by fans today.

From Music to Making Things!

After his music days, Rick Buckler tried something new. He became a carpenter, which means he built things like cabinets and furniture! It’s like he swapped his drumsticks for a hammer. But guess what? He loved music so much that he came back to it later with new bands, playing all the old Jam songs for people to enjoy!
